Analysis

Iceland recorded -18.0% for annual percentage change in primary energy from wind in 2025.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 123.7% on the previous year and down 160.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, annual percentage change in primary energy from wind in Iceland peaked at 75.8% in 2024 and was at its lowest, -100.0%, in 2012.

That places Iceland 69th out of 71 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
